## Limits & Quotas — Pagerloom Deduplicator

Pagerloom collapses duplicate alerts per service within a rolling window. Exceeding the per-team ingest quota drops the oldest unacknowledged duplicates first; originals are never dropped. Support should not raise quotas without platform sign-off. Escalate if a team hits the ceiling twice in one week. The enforced limits are defined by these constants.

tuning table, kajog-kawef:
PRIORITIES = {
    "kelox": 870,
    "kasix": 89,
    "eliax": 988,
}

TURN-208: Gatevale turnstile counters at the Merrow Field pilot double-count when a rotation reverses mid-cycle. Attendance totals drift roughly 2% high per event. The debounce window fix is implemented, reviewed by Ilsa, and soak-tested across two simulated match days without drift. Ready for your cut; the candidate build is identified below.

trace token, tagag-tafog: htk6_5ed18c

Changelog — Quillbridge SDK parity (week 14). As part of the scheduled key rotation, we aligned the Kestrelline Android and iOS SDKs: both now expose identical retry semantics, the same offline cache eviction policy, and matching telemetry field names. The rotation required re-signing all release artifacts for both platforms, so parity testing was run against freshly signed builds. No behavioral drift was observed in the Marrowfield staging suite. The new signing key for both pipelines follows below.

deploy key for kajof-fajop: bky6_gDHw9Q